Usage
{{flagCAC|code|games|athletes}}
This template is used to display a small flag and country name, with a wikilink to the country's page for the specified Central American and Caribbean Games.
- code is an International Olympic Committee country code (see List of IOC country codes).
- games is a year. The intent is to have a full set of pages of the form "<country> at the <year> Central American and Caribbean Games" and the intent is that this template can be used from medal tables and event result tables to point to the right country page (similar to pages created for the Olympics and Pan Am Games).
- athletes is the number of athletes that the nation contributed to the specific Games. It is an optional argument, and will render a small (#) after the nation's name.
